The Court has received and considered the United States’ case management conference
statement, and its request to stay this case until the prosecution in a related case is completed
and to continue the case management conference. The Court is inclined to stay this matter
pending resolution of the related criminal case. However, because it is not yet clear whether
claimant Hui Jin Chen will be represented by counsel in this case, the Court will not issue a
final ruling on that request. The Court CONTINUES the case management conference
scheduled for June 12, 2015 to July 31, 2015 at 11:00 a.m. The parties shall file a further case
management conference statement by July 24, 2015. If Claimant will be proceeding without
counsel, the parties may file separate case management statements.
